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Парсинг email-письма в Qt / 3 сообщений из 3, страница 1 из 1
05.11.2010, 22:49
    #36939741
Парсинг email-письма в Qt
Подскажите пожалуйста, как отпарсить входящее e-mail-письмо. То есть, мне нужно из входящей информации выделить адрес, от кого пришло, расшифровать тему письма, зашифрованную base64 с указанием кодировки а самое основное - полностью перебросить в массив заголовки MIME со значениями и отделить само по себе сообщение.
Разработка нужна под Qt ну или сторонние Linux-библиотеки.
...
Рейтинг: 0 / 0
06.11.2010, 02:09
    #36939866
Парсинг email-письма в Qt
Или хотя бы подскажите, где найти мануал по расшифровке Subject в письме.
Дело в том, что я могу расшифровать сам текст заголовка и его кодировку, но некоторые параметры непонятны.
Например:

Subject: =?UTF-16LE?B?GgQ+BD0ERAQ1BEAENQQ9BEYEOARPBCAAMgA5AA==?=
ограничивается ли заголовок только символами "=?" и "?=" или есть какие-то другие ограничители.
Что есть "?B?", что есть "LE" после кодировки?
...
Рейтинг: 0 / 0
06.11.2010, 03:40
    #36939878
White Owl
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Парсинг email-письма в Qt
Малахов ДмитрийИли хотя бы подскажите, где найти мануал по расшифровке Subject в письме.
Дело в том, что я могу расшифровать сам текст заголовка и его кодировку, но некоторые параметры непонятны.
Например:

Subject: =?UTF-16LE?B?GgQ+BD0ERAQ1BEAENQQ9BEYEOARPBCAAMgA5AA==?=
ограничивается ли заголовок только символами "=?" и "?=" или есть какие-то другие ограничители.
Что есть "?B?", что есть "LE" после кодировки?UTF-16LE это не кодировка. Это кодовая страница шрифта. Кодировка это ?B? - означает что дальнейшая строка (до ?=) зашифрована Base64.
Короче говоря читай это: http://tools.ietf.org/html/rfc2045
...
Рейтинг: 0 / 0
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Парсинг email-письма в Qt / 3 сообщений из 3,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]